Transaction 341dd8c88c7836eff642fc16e13c42ec731878d0370f82f1ef8068f3a1a96958
1 Input
1 Output
-
341dd8c88c7836eff642fc16e13c42ec731878d0370f82f1ef8068f3a1a96958:0
- value
- 318130
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d389e371dec43976f12f97a319a59f9fd0bbdeee O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LHWm8nBWoW4RB6xv8ZPbJhLuSk1F6MFWs